I have a Canon EOS 650 SLR for almost 20 years, which is a cracking idiot-proof (in auto-focus mode) camera, and to which I am now going to return because of the picture quality compared to small digital jobs! However, I have 2 Sigma lenses, 28-70, and 70-210, and the 28-70 (which I used the most) has given up the ghost (not bad after all the years that I used it) and will not autofocus. As so many photographers have now moved over to digital, and there may be lots of used SLR lenses for sale, what would be my best option:

* replace the 28-70 with another comparable lens suitable for SLR
* purchase a single lens to cover approximately the same range as the 2 existing lenses
* either of the above, but using a new digital compatible lens with an adapter (can this be done?)

If second hand lenses are an option, where do I find them (e-bay is a quagmire!)
